Harmonious Balance

Contemporary design that inspires—where modern aesthetics create the ideal dental practice environment

The Good Smile dental practice brings together functional clarity and contemporary design across 240 m². Its most distinctive feature—housed in a former medical laboratory—is an extraordinary ceiling height that reaches an impressive 4.3 metres at its peak, creating a naturally open and airy experience.

The pd raumplan concept works with a restrained palette of black, warm greys, and soft beige tones—refined through the thoughtful introduction of striking materials. Metallic reflective surfaces take centre stage in the reception, appearing on the counter and extending floor-to-ceiling across the walls. Horizontal divisions punctuate these elements, emphasising the impressive ceiling height while creating visual rhythm. This design language repeats throughout: in the black wood panelling beside the counter, the glass partition into the waiting area, and the felt-lined feature wall—each becoming a signature motif. Organic paper fixtures provide a softer counterpoint to the geometric precision, echoing the counter's curved form. The interplay of cool metallic surfaces with warm wood and beige tones achieves a true balance between coolness and warmth. The waiting room emerges as the heart of the design. A suspended acoustic fixture—1.56 metres tall—floats at the room's centre, anchoring the space vertically in a way only the exceptional ceiling height allows. Forest-motif wallpaper reinforces the colour palette, while the felt-covered feature wall ties the reception and waiting areas into one cohesive whole. The forest theme continues into the treatment rooms, where the ceiling dramatically rises to its full 4.3 metres above each chair, with skylights that enhance the sense of openness. The wallpaper becomes theatrical against this soaring light well, creating a dynamic spatial experience. A terrazzo-look floor with metallic flecks echoes the material and colour story throughout. The result is an integrated design—functional yet beautiful, modern yet warm—that transforms the patient experience into something genuinely welcoming and inspiring.
